The Scope of the Problem
Head injuries remain one of the most serious consequences of cycling accidents. Research shows that helmets can reduce the risk of severe brain injury by up to 88 percent. Yet helmet usage varies widely by region, age, and cycling discipline. Educating riders on the stark difference between helmeted and unhelmeted crashes is the first step toward safer streets and trails.

Material Science
Modern bike helmets leverage advanced materials engineered for energy absorption and impact resistance. Expanded polystyrene foam, or EPS, is the most common liner; it crushes on impact to dissipate force. High-density polycarbonate shells add structural integrity, preventing penetration from sharp objects. Manufacturers continuously refine these layers, balancing stiffness, durability, and weight to maximize protection without hindering comfort.

Getting the Right Fit
A well-fitting helmet sits level on your head, covering the forehead without tilting backward. Straps should form a snug “Y” shape around each ear, and you should be able to slide one or two fingers between the chin strap and your jaw. A proper fit not only enhances protection but also prevents distracting movement during a ride. Always try on multiple sizes and adjust all buckles before setting off.

Key Features of Modern Helmets
Today’s helmets come loaded with innovations that cater to diverse rider needs:

Adjustable ventilation channels for climate control and sweat management

Removable visors to shield eyes from sun, rain, and debris

Quick-release buckles and micro-dial fit systems for rapid adjustments

Reflective accents or integrated LED lights for enhanced visibility

These features transform a basic safety device into a tailored piece of gear that complements your riding style.

Styles for Every Ride
Cycling isn’t one-size-fits-all, and helmet designs reflect that diversity. Road helmets emphasize aerodynamics and lightweight construction, while mountain bike lids prioritize coverage around the back and sides of the head. Urban commuters often choose minimalist, skate-style helmets with integrated lighting mounts. Even kids’ helmets combine playful graphics with the same protective technologies found in adult models.

Safety Standards
Before hitting the pavement, ensure your helmet meets or exceeds relevant safety certifications. In the United States, look for CPSC approval. European riders should check for CE EN 1078 compliance, and Australian families can rely on the AS/NZS 2063 standard. These certifications guarantee that the helmet has passed rigorous tests for impact attenuation, strap strength, and peripheral vision.

Cutting-Edge Technologies
Innovations like the Multi-Directional Impact Protection System (MIPS) add a low-friction layer inside the helmet to reduce rotational forces on the brain during angled impacts. Other brands integrate Koroyd or WaveCel materials that crumple more predictably under stress. Smart helmets equipped with sensors can even detect a crash and send an alert to emergency contacts via your smartphone.

Maintenance, Replacement, and Conclusion
A helmet’s protective capabilities diminish over time and after any significant impact. Inspect yours regularly for cracks, dents, or compromised foam. Replace it every three to five years—even without a crash—since UV exposure and sweat can degrade materials. And if you do take a spill, swap out your helmet immediately.
